Secure real-time communication between smart meters and enterprise applications.

HES acts as the critical bridge connecting distributed field meters to your core software ecosystem. Acquire meter data, issue remote configuration commands, and manage fleet health in real time.

How It Works

Reliable communication across your physical smart meter infrastructure.

Device Handshake

Establish encrypted communication sessions with field meters.

Data Acquisition

Fetch billing, profile, and event logs on scheduled intervals.

Protocol Conversion

Translate device-specific payloads into standardized data formats.

Alarm Triggering

Immediately route urgent grid alerts to operational dashboards.

Data Transfer

Stream structured device logs directly to the MDMS engine.

Remote Execution

Send remote cut-off or config commands back down to meters.
